Tutorial shows how to bind off and connect ends of an infinity scarf while it is still on the loom.The Purl bind-off method creates a firm edge. It works in a similar fashion as the knit bind-off method except that it uses the purl stitch. It is useful for binding off a project that is knit in reverse stockinette stitch or one that has a garter stitch at the end. The Provisional bind-off method is used to close the end of the knitting by gathering or to leave stitches open for grafting, fringing, etc. When using it for the former, use the same yarn; when using it for the later, use a contrasting slippery yarn. You should choose the method below based the stitch pattern you are using before closing the item.

Watch on.Casting off takes your project off the knitting loom and finishes the edge at the same time! The cinched bind off uses a yarn needle to pull the yarn through each loop before you pull it tight to close the end. Use this cast off to finish hats and bags! It’s also the fastest way to get your project off the loom.

ABBREVIATIONS. BO = Bind off - Knit Peg 1, knit Peg 2, move 2 onto 1 and knit off (bottom loop over top). EWYO = EWrap Yarnover - Ewrap the empty peg.[NOTE: Peg must be Ewrapped to set up the stitch correctly. Do not use a yarnover that wraps only the front of the peg.] K = Uwrap knit Rem = Remaining Rep = Repeat Sl = Slip Stitch - Skip the peg. Loom knit snowflakes, a lesson in I-cord bind off. When I posted Boo-Ella I promised to follow up on the new technique I developed for the ruffled edge of her skirt which I call the I-cord bind off. It is really very easy to do and creates a nice picot edge that could be used on baby items or any place you want a little added decoration.

Once you …This bind off is another very stretchy method that we actually recommend for patterns with a wide gauge, such as lace patterns. This will work better than more tight methods, which would cause the lace to bunch up at the bind off edge. The tutorial below is showing you how to cast out without a stretch applied to it.Here’s how you weave in yarn tails after you’re done with the knitting loom cast off: Step 1: Turn the project inside out. Thread the yarn tail through the yarn needle. Step 2: Weave the needle through either a row of stitches or column of stitches for 1-2”. Step 3: Pull the yarn through the stitches and trim the extra yarn close to the ...Note: This tutorial was written for right-handed knitters.
